Country DenmarkJob Family Client SolutionsOur MissionAt Consumer Panel Services GfK, our mission is clear: to provide key information on who buys what, where, how much, how often, and most importantly, why (or why not). We take pride in delivering high-quality, uninterrupted data, expert consultancy, and unparalleled expertise to empower our clients to deliver superior customer experiences at every stage of the shopper journey.Job DescriptionThe Market Research Consultant in our Advanced Solutions Team (AST), is responsible for maintaining and developing client relationships together with the account managers. Reporting to our AST Nordics Team Lead also based in Copenhagen, the Market Research Consultant, AST primarily works on analytics and ad hoc solutions that combine and leverage classic panel data (i.e. actual shopper behaviour) with other quantitative/qualitative research. The Market Research Consultant, AST works independently in a warm-hearted team of skilled colleagues who take pride in their work and with support from local and global experts will answer our clients’ questions by offering relevant and useful solution options.You Will:Contribute to the development and growth of the Advanced Solution businessImplement and manage solutions for better insights across disciplinesPlan, set up, and monitor projectsDeliver outstanding client consultancy with actionable insights and consultative storytellingPlan and activate marketing and sales activitiesSupport other consultants to deliver solutions and presentationsYou Have:A robust and energetic personality with a high level of drive & engagement.Proven experience in different shopper research methodologies (panel, ad hoc, passive measurement)University degree in Economics or Social Sciences, ideally with a focus on MarketingExcellent skills with Excel and PowerPoint; knowledge of SPSS is an advantageExperience in similar tasks (agency or client-side) is beneficial, but curiosity and potential matter moreExcellent analytical skills, able to recognise insight from data setsSolid presentation skillsKnowledge of the Nordic FMCG marketFluent Swedish or Danish language skillsFluent English language skillsKnowledge of the Danish and Norwegian FMCG markets is desirableVacancy is based in either our Stockholm or Copenhagen offices with hybrid working.We are an ethical and honest company that is wholly committed to its clients and employees.
